> Looks like a known DMC firmware bug, where toggling DC6 enabled state can
> corrupt registers backed by DC6 power context. There is an internal bug
> ticket opened for this, I'm planning to provide more debug info to the
> firmware team and convince them to fix it.
> 
> One register that can get corrupted is GEN8_MASTER_IRQ leaving all i915
> interrupts disabled, that would also explain the missing ctx switch
> interrupt.
